Job Description

  • To contribute to the development and maintenance of the Group Financial Crime Compliance Regulatory Risk Oversight, Advisory and Training Framework.
  • Secondly to implement said Framework across designated countries and jurisdictions, to ensure that business is undertaken in a compliant manner to avoid operational losses, fines, penalties or reputational damage to the organisation and to enable the competitive advantage of the organisation.

Qualifications

  • Degree in Risk Management, Business Commerce, Legal or related

Experience Required

Group Anti Financial Crime

Compliance

  • 3-4 years - Extensive experience in AML/CFT policy drafting and monitoring experience with experience in an AML/CFT advisory role. Good working knowledge of financial sector environment and procedures.
  • In depth knowledge and understanding of the legislative and regulatory requirements as it relates to financial institutions as well as internal compliance related policies and procedures.
